Game Videos - Dianjinwa Video - Free Hot Videos

Terry Bogard is the latest downloadable character in Super Smash Bros
Game
Terry Bogard is the latest downloadable character in Super Smash Bros
LOL: The Ultimate Duel
Game
7.2